About Sleeth Electrical and Solar
Bob leads Sleeth Electrical with a hands-on approach that customers most often mention for solar installations and general electrical work across Melbourne's southeast. Reviews suggest he personally visits each property for consultations and brings the actual installation crew back for a second site visit to confirm placement and viability before work begins. The team includes Mick and other installers who customers consistently praise for neat, thorough work and complete site cleanup. Bob and office manager Sharne handle all the paperwork including government rebates and utility company notifications, creating what multiple customers describe as a stress-free process. Based on review patterns, they appear to focus on residential solar installations with quality components like LG panels and Fronius inverters, plus ongoing maintenance including free one-year service visits.
Best for residential solar installations with thorough consultation process, customers wanting complete rebate paperwork handling, and homeowners seeking ongoing electrical service relationships.

What's Bob's consultation process like at Sleeth Electrical?+
Based on customer reviews, Bob personally visits your property first to assess your needs and provide quotes. He then brings the actual installation team back for a second site visit to confirm panel placement and ensure the proposed system is viable for your specific roof and requirements. Multiple customers mention this thorough two-visit approach as distinctive compared to other solar companies.
Does Sleeth Electrical handle the paperwork for government solar rebates?+
Yes, customers consistently mention that Bob and office manager Sharne handle all the paperwork including government grant applications and notifying your power company about the new installation. Several reviews specifically praise this complete service, with one customer noting the inspector came out the very next day after installation to certify and activate the system.
What do customers say about Sleeth Electrical's cleanup and workmanship?+
Reviews consistently highlight their thorough cleanup with complete rubbish removal from site. Customers describe the installations as 'immaculate' and 'neat and tidy', with particular praise for attention to detail in panel placement based on customer preferences. One customer noted their system has worked flawlessly for almost three years since installation.
Do they provide ongoing service after solar installation?+
Yes, at least one customer mentions receiving a free clean and service of their solar panels and inverter one year after installation. Reviews suggest they provide ongoing support, with customers noting Bob as their 'go to' for all electrical work beyond just the initial solar installation.
